1.2.3.4 ECU REMOVAL
1. Disconnect battery.
2. Remove steering wheel.
3. Remove the steering nacel covers.
4. Remove combi switch assembly (if required).
5. Disconnect the electrical connections from the
ECU
6. Remove four bolts securing steering column
assembly to the mounting bracket and carefully
lower the steering column.
7. Loosen and remove the mounting fasteners of
the ECU mounting bracket.
8. Remove the ECU along with the bracket care-
fully.
REFITMENT:
For assembly follow reverse procedure of removal.
